When I started to code 25 years ago, there was no choice but as soon as I discovered IDEs I never looked back.
Startup speed may be an issue, but it is I believe insignificant for a coding session (of a few hours). Key bindings are portable. IDEs bring code completion, integrated debugging etc.
I am really curious.